Ark. Code Ann. § 12-13-305

Enforcement

Acts 1981, No. 123, § 5; A.S.A. 1947, § 66-5605.

(1) No person shall knowingly refuse to provide authorized agencies with relevant information pursuant to this subchapter.

(2) No person shall fail to hold in confidence information required to be held in confidence by this subchapter.

(3) Whoever violates this section is guilty of a Class A misdemeanor.
